    Okay, so let me start off by saying, if you come on a rainy day expect to standing, atleast for a little. There are only about 5 tables inside, and then outside they have some picnic tables. Because it was raining, and people were standing, people who had the tables tried their best to eat and leave, and not just hang around - which I think displays the kindness of both the customers and staff! By the time I got my food I was able to sit down and eat, which worked out perfectly! I got the big meaty hash (add spinach and cheese sauce) w/ wheat toast and a black currant mandarin mimosa. The meaty hash is sooo good and so filling, make sure to get extra extra of the cheese sauce, it just really ties everything together, and the spinach because it makes me feel a tiny bit healthy lol. For the toast I asked for jam, and usually I wouldn't just leave a review about the jam but OMG it was really good! If you're like I don't need jam for my toast, get it anyway, trust me lol. For the mimosa I was going back and forth on whether I wanted to try a classic (orange or pineapple) or try something different, the cashier talked me into trying something different and I'm glad he did! If you like the flavor of sangria then you'll love this mimosa! The mimosa was $12 for one but I was feeling tipsy 1/4 of the way in so they give you your moneys worth lol. All in all I will definitely go by this place again next time I'm in Charleston, if you're staying downtown, it's worth the drive!!!

    Stopped in to Daps for a quick lunch. It was pretty slow near their closing time (we came around 1pm), so no trouble getting a seat and didn't have to wait long for the food. Went with their cheeseburger, which is a patty melt with an egg on white bread. Pretty good overall, it had pickled, grilled onions, sauce, an egg, and was served with a cheese sauce which was different (and good). Also had the banh mi - which was just ok, wouldn't order again. The pork belly was too sweet - it was a maple glaze (menu just says glazed). Needed more pickled veggies (they needed to have more acid as well) to offset that sweetness, but the pork mousse helped a bit. Anyway, I see what they were going for but it missed the mark if we're gonna call it a banh mi. The hash browns were great - I like the long thing strands of potato, like spaghetti almost. Wish there were more well done parts - those were the best with added texture. This was also served with the cheese sauce, onions, and a piece of toast.
